Rotary Art I've been tinkering with

Hey all. In between builds coming through the shop I've been tinkering with making cool conversation pieces more so to help me explain to people how the engine actually works. I make them out of trashed 13b and 12a engines that have flow through here constantly. I might start selling them. Maybe code match housings to Generation specific paint with whatever accent color for the rotor the consumer wants. Thoughts ?
